Transaction 63a5aca6483068ef387dad69ae1eba8330f5c42b3b2f84df12b202c5062cc7b5

1 Input
2 Outputs
  • 63a5aca6483068ef387dad69ae1eba8330f5c42b3b2f84df12b202c5062cc7b5:0
  • value  21481511
    address  bc1qcfgzsmm3dud2ygc0qkwsr9w5mwfehtrmawny2k
  • 63a5aca6483068ef387dad69ae1eba8330f5c42b3b2f84df12b202c5062cc7b5:1
  • value  653276
    address  13njrRzXJv4AwDBKuBdHoGz6bsgbSvk8UB